§ 3731

LAB § 3731Div. 4 · Part 1 · Ch. 4 · Art. 2
Any stop order or penalty assessment order may be personally served upon the employer either by (1) manual delivery of the order to the employer personally or by (2) leaving signed copies of the order during usual office hours with the person who is apparently in charge of the office and by thereafter mailing copies of the order by first class mail, postage prepaid to the employer at the place where signed copies of the order were left.

Legislative history

Added by Stats. 1980, Ch. 852.
